    Experimental Methods for Engineers KMÜ311 FALL-SPRING 3+0 E 3
    Learning Outcomes
    1-To plan experimental study
    2-To calculate experimental uncertainties of measurement
    3-To apply methods of measurement temperature, pressure and flow
    4-To analyze experimental data

    Goals This course in Experimental Methods is aimed to provide students with theory and hands-on laboratory experience, including simple and more complex experiments and computerized data acquisition. Strong emphasis is placed on problem solving, professional judgment, and the importance of accuracy, error, and uncertainty analysis. To teach basic concepts about process variables, temperature, pressure, flowrate measurements
    Content Basic concepts of measurement methods and planning and documenting experiments. Typical sensors, transducers, and measurements system behavior. Data sampling and computerized data acquisition systems. Statistical methods and uncertainty analysis applied to data reduction. Laboratory experiments with measurement of selected material properties and solid mechanical and fluid/thermal quantities.
